The BHASO Care Coordination Supervisor will organize, collect, review and report behavioral health, social determinant of health and/or physical health information through Individual phone in-reach and outreach, while demonstrating multicultural responsiveness and effective communication skills with Medicaid members. This position follows established safety protocols in the community setting, as well as established preventive and disease management programs for health promotion and education. Deliver culturally responsive information regarding the availability of health and community resources that will reduce barriers to care. Connect Individuals to payers and services that the Individual is eligible for. Work collaboratively with the Regional Accountable Entities and the state. Lead care navigators and other team members involved in direct or indirect coordination of care.

Primary Responsibilities:
• Serves as a consultant to care coordination teams
• Provide direct care navigation, coordination and management for the BHASO
• Respect confidentiality and maintain confidences as described in the UHG Employee Handbook and acknowledged through signature by all employees. The ability to maintain confidentiality is a critical and essential component of this position
• Participate in Interdisciplinary care team meetings as indicated
• Serve as community liaison and maintain relationships with key individuals in the community and serve as an advocate by coordinating linkages or referrals to improve health, social, and environmental conditions for Individuals
• Coordinate and perform duties of communicating the mission and role of the organization to community based organizations
• Conduct Individual assessments
• Assess the changing needs and condition of the Individual and family and communicate this information to all involved Care Coordinators, community partners, providers and other appropriate individuals, according to department policies and procedures
• Document assessments, Individual/family response to care coordination interventions at the time of the encounter. Meet departmental standards and deadlines for timely completion of all required documentation and meet current agency productivity standards
• Educate and assist identified Individuals about behaviors that can enhance their health, successfully navigating the health system
• Facilitate connection and access to identified treatment needs
• Develop a plan of management associated with health care goals for each Individual addressing the diverse needs in a culturally responsive way
• Develop and maintain a report system for outcomes
• Communicate Individual issues requiring interventions to appropriate departments and providers
• Maintain confidentiality and uses only the minimum amount of protected health information (PHI) necessary to accomplish job related responsibilities. Maintain confidentiality of Individual information
• Participate in staff meetings, case conferences and in-services. Maintain familiarity with all policies and procedures that impact decisions and care
